Household size: For the past several years, the mean number of people in a household has been declining. A social scientist believes that in a certain large city, the mean number of people per household is less than 2.5. To investigate this, she takes a simple random sample of 150 households in the city, and finds that the sample mean number of people is 2.3 with a sample standard deviation of 1.5. Can you conclude that the mean number of people per household is less than 2.5?

1.Compute the value of the test statistic. Round your answer to three decimal places.
